Our internet is awful!
We pay for ultra fast broadband. My daughter works from home and is constantly having to give up with her connection to go into the office. We are having to turn off and on the WiFi on our phones and reset our boxes constantly. It's driving us mad. We have a booster too and it's still not good enough. The tests online have said our connection is fine, but it's not. I pay almost £200 a month for this poor service. How do I speak to someone to fix this?! Or order a new broadband box.

Re: Our internet is awful!
@steph172 No way on earth you should be paying that kind off money for that speed of BB connection? What sky hub do you have and if not done so run a diagnostic against the line! You should only need to reset the sky Hub by power off/on mode, the booster should follow and reconnect automatically! Ultrafast BB to a speed of 150Mb/s is still on a G.Fast copper line, if it's got issues with the line then you may just need to get a OR engineer to check it all out if the checker below does not find anything,
Try running the line test here to see if any faults are found:
https://www.sky.com/help/articles/broadband-diagnostic-start
You can also run the test via the MySky app on a mobile data connection.
Once completed, if it reports back that all is good click on 'broadband' to run an updated test. If you get amber or red you need to follow the on-screen instructions.
If you’re still having problems you may need to call Sky to report it. Dial 150 free from your Sky Talk landline (if it’s still working).
